Justin Sherman’s Summary

I have been a part of the team at the Austin Medical Center, part of Mayo Health System for over a year now. During 2008 great strides were taken in LEAN training with staff, beginning to redesign our lab using LEAN principles, a mammography VSM, amongst many successes.

In 2008 I made some new networking connections as I became a member of:
-Mayo Health System Patient Safety Committee
-Mayo Health System Quality Management Team
-Mayo Health System Quality Director's

In 2009 we have some ambitious goals in regards to leadership training, further staff LEAN training that should help us in this treacherous economic environment, and implementing some new IHI related initiatives.

Previously I worked in process engineering and quality management at Lake City Medical Center, part of the Mayo Clinic Health System. There I worked to secure a grant from Minnesota Job Skills Partnership, MJSP, for $340,000 to implement a LEAN health care training program at the hospital. The grant was a partnership between SE Tech, Riverland College and Lake City Medical Center. The training began in April 2007 and will last 3 years. All staff were touched by this training; this was more than 500 employees.

  • Lean Facilitator

    Lake City Medical Center

    (Privately Held; 201-500 employees; Hospital & Health Care industry)

    June 2006December 2007 (1 year 7 months)

    •Responsible for lean and process engineering training for all levels of staff.
    •Took primary role in developing curriculum for the Minnesota Job Skills Partnership (MJSP) grant that awarded $342,000 to Lake City Medical Center on November 6, 2006.
    •Will train over 500 employees at 5 locations during the 3 year grant
    •Redesigned outpatient physical therapy schedule allowing for a 19%, or approximately a $71,000 increase in billed charges
    •Provider scheduling pilot project realized a 15.4% increase in RVU’s, approximately $47,000 annualized increase in billed charges
    •Guided staff by facilitating team training in areas such as kaizen, 5S, VSM, root cause, 5-why’s, control plans, process mapping, and auditing.
    •Worked with direct patient care personnel as well as hospital business operations staff to improve processes directly affecting the patient and elevate staff job satisfaction.
    •Took lead role in creating standardized work instructions for the medical center.
